The single girder crane is divided into three main parts: the large carriage running mechanism, the small carriage running mechanism, and the lifting mechanism (electric hoist). The lifting mechanism is responsible for the lifting and lowering of heavy loads in a vertical direction, the small carriage running mechanism handles the left and right movement of the lifting mechanism and the heavy load parallel to the main girder, and the large carriage running mechanism operates on the crane beam, responsible for the overall movement of the single girder crane within the entire workshop space. The three parts of the crane work together to facilitate the handling of heavy loads to any position in three-dimensional space.

When using the hook as the lifting device, the operation process is as follows: operate the remote control to lower the hook to an appropriate position, secure the heavy load, then raise the hook slightly with the remote control to confirm the load is securely tied. Continue to raise the hook to the desired height, then operate the large vehicle to the target location. Use the small vehicle to accurately position the heavy load above the target. Finally, operate the electric hoist to place the heavy load precisely at the target location, completing the task.
